170310-N-GP548-1318 PHILIPPINE SEA (March 10, 2017) The Arleigh Burke-class guided-missile destroyer USS Mustin (DDG 89) leads U.S. Navy and Japan Maritime Self-Defense Force ships in formation during MultiSail 17. The bilateral training exercise is designed to improve interoperability between the U.S. and Japanese forces. (U.S. Navy photo by Mass Communication Specialist 1st Class Elijah G. Leinaar/Released)
